                        @thomthom said:

                        I just need to make sure it doesn't have any other unintended side-effects.

                        Please no, or at least make this as an option one can toggle on/off, because in general hidden geometry is BAD. 😐
                        IMHO it would be a more clean workflow to do all the modeling avoiding hidden geometry and only at the last stage, when finalizing geometry for rendering, select all the smoothed edges (select all geometery and then run "selection toys -> select only -> soft edges") and turn them invisible.

                        @vizan said:

                        Thank you for your attention to this!
                        I noticed that the FredoCorner plugin does this automatically.

                        Fredo corner plugin has an option for this in "rounding parameters->borders->inner edges" and you can toggle.
                        I think that's a good approach, because it can be adapted for different workflows.
